BACKGROUND: Although international guidelines recommend discussions about goals of care and treatment options for children with severe and life-limiting conditions, there are still few structured models of paediatric advance care planning. AIM: The study aimed at identifying key components of paediatric advance care planning through direct discussions with all involved parties. DESIGN: The study had a qualitative design with a participatory approach. Participants constituted an advisory board and took part in two transdisciplinary workshops. Data were collected in discussion and dialogue groups and analysed using content analysis. SETTING/PARTICIPANTS: We included bereaved parents, health care providers and stakeholders of care networks.
